Mobile Outreach Vehicle in Angel Fire!
The New Mexico Department of Veterans’ Services (NMDVS) Mobile Outreach Vehicle will be in Angel Fire at the Vietnam Memorial, 34 Country Club Rd., from 8: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. on May 7th.
They will also be in Mora at VFW Post 1131, 2825 Hwy 518, from 10: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m on May 6th.
Veterans can meet one-on-one with a Veteran Service Officer for assistance with VA and New Mexico State benefit applications. Our team will also provide guidance on healthcare, compensation, pensions, education benefits, and state programs and services available to veterans and their families.
Documents needed to verify eligibility:
- A copy of DD-214, NA 13038, NOAA Form 56-16, or PHS Form 1867
- VA Award Letter showing the percentage of disability and any other VA correspondence related to claiming benefits
- NM Driver’s License, ID, voter registration card, or the most recent NM Personal Income Tax Return
- Widow/Widower copy of marriage and death certificates
This is an opportunity to ask questions, receive information, and get help claiming the benefits you have earned.
